Mermaid diagrams

  Markdown

This is currently a Goblin Lab feature which needs to be enabled per campaign in the lab tab of the campaign settings.

The Goblin’s Notebook supports Mermaid diagrams in your notes. Mermaid lets you create diagrams and charts using simple text, which is particularly useful for visualising relationships, processes, timelines and other things in your campaign.

Adding a Mermaid diagram

Mermaid diagrams are added using a code block with mermaid as the language, for example:

```mermaid
flowchart LR
    A[The Goblin] --> B[The Dungeon]
    B --> C[The Dragon]
    B --> D[The Treasure]
```

When you view the object, the code will automatically be replaced with the diagram.

You can edit the Mermaid code just like any other part of your markdown.

Mermaid supports a wide range of diagram types, including flowcharts, pie charts, Gantt charts, mind maps, timelines, quadrant charts, and more.

You can use object references in the form of @[](objectid) in the mermaid definition which will resolve to the object name. You cannot currently make it so that clicking the diagram navigates to objects.

A note about Mermaid

The links above take you to Mermaid’s official documentation, which is kept up to date with the latest features and examples. The Mermaid version used in The Goblin’s Notebook is v12.0.0.
